characteristics: |
silvery white, lustrous, solid metal. soluble in sulfuric acid, nitric acid, potassium hydroxide and potassium cyanide solution. insoluble in water. imparts garlic-like odor to breath, can be depilatory. it is a p-type semiconductor and its conductivity is sensitive to light exposure. |
hazards: |
(metal and compounds, as te): toxic by inhalation. tolerance: 0.1 mg/m3 of air. |
applications: |
tellurium could be used in different fields, according to its purity. it could be used as infrared detector materials, solar cell material, cooling material and so on. mainly applied for compound semi-conductor, solar energy cell, electrothermic transition element, cooling element,air-sensitive,thermosensitive,pressure-sensitive,photosensitive,piezo-electric crystal and nuclear radiation detect, infrared detector and basic material. |
symbol: |
te |
cas: |
13494-80-9 |
atomic number: |
52 |
atomic weight: |
127.60 |
density: |
6.24 gm/cc |
melting point: |
449.5 ℃ |
boiling point: |
989.8 ℃ |
thermal conductivity: |
- |
electrical resistivity: |
4.36x10(5) microhm-cm @ 25 ℃ |
electronegativity: |
2.1 paulings |
specific heat: |
0.0481 cal/g/ok @ 25℃ |
heat of vaporization: |
11.9 k-cal/gm atom at 989.8 ℃ |
heat of fusion: |
3.23 cal/gm mole |
